WebMar 17, 2024 · Maria Martinez (1887-1980) is perhaps the most famous female Native American artist of the 20th century, a true matriarch of her Pueblo, and is a well-known … WebNov 3, 2016 · “Maria Martinez: Indian Pottery of San Ildefonso” is a 1972 documentary that gives the audience a look into how Maria Martinez, a Tewa artist in the San Ildefonso Pueblo creates her famous black pieces of pottery. Her style consists of shiny, polished black items with matte-black designs.
